Output 2f624acfa8aa8a32bf75b53ce15575c6852300e6bfdc3a77ad44ae17688f9dda:6

value
334681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c42dd142b8f25186ea68d4214c038e1c237b04 OP_EQUAL
address
358hwPtye6E3xo8LqfHHm1bQVq2Eiss76S
transaction
2f624acfa8aa8a32bf75b53ce15575c6852300e6bfdc3a77ad44ae17688f9dda
confirmations
421518
spent
true